Project Identification
- Provide Six Sigma support to our senior executives and business unit managers including business case development, and strategic project identification.
- Support the identification and evaluation of the organization’s process improvement opportunities.
Project Execution
- Lead and contribute to process improvement solutions within the business that include moderate, ambiguous, and complex projects.
- Manage tactical and strategic projects to deliver incremental cost/expense reductions, improve customer experience, and increase organizational efficiency.
- Organize, lead, and facilitate cross-functional project teams
- Collect and analyze data to identify root causes of defects; measure performance against process requirements; and align improvement to performance shortfalls
- Develop metrics that provide data for process measurement, identifying indicators for future improvement opportunities
- Monitor and communicate the results of process improvement projects to management and the business owners and stakeholders.
Change Leadership
- Develop and maintain productive stakeholder, staff, and management relationships through individual contacts and group meetings.
- Act as a change agent driving cultural change focused on our business’s and its customers’ success.
- Apply influence and change management skills to ensure project success.
- Support the business in learning Six Sigma methodologies,including appropriate defined tools, measurement, analysis, improvement, and control concepts, through presentations and training.
Mentoring
- Mentor & coach Green Belts in project work, helping them understand and use Work-Out, Lean, and Six Sigma for successful and timely completion of projects
